  • 1. Accounting policies

    Basis of measurement and preparation

    These financial statements have been prepared in accordance with the provisions of Section 1A (Small Entities) of Financial Reporting Standard 102

    Turnover policy

    Turnover represents the value, net of value added tax of subscriptions received and other services provided to customers and subscribers. All turnover is attributable to markets within the UK

    Tangible fixed assets depreciation policy

    Depreciation has been provided at the following rates in order to write off the company assets over their estimated useful lives. Fixtures and fittings – 25% reducing balance method Intangible assets – 10% straight line method

Company activities and impact

The company operates the website careopinion.org.uk for users of health and social care services across Scotland. The website enables users of health and social care services to feedback anonymously and safely about their experiences of care with a view to making services better through service improvements. The wider community of the UK benefit from the shared learning and service improvements that are generated because of the platform. In the last year Care Opinion consolidated its work in all parts of Scotland, and continued to expand both the support and website development teams to ensure that its values of re-investing any surplus in service improvement is kept. Each year the company publishes an annual review outlining its work and developments to its service across Scotland which is available on its website.
